>>96131505Yeah the vast majority of the deck is dirt cheap and I expect most of it to stay that way. But there are a few things I think you may want to pick up before the Advanced deck releases, or ideally before reveals even start. Because regardless of any specific new cards the deck will add, it's going to drive up interest in the deck and therefore increase demand.
Ruin Mode, the only bank-breaker in the deck right now, is actually at its lowest price since the deck took off after its surprise 3rd place finish at Worlds in March. It's a powerful generic tool for Yellow and Purple, but currently Sakuyamon is the only well-represented deck that's playing it. Because Sakuyamon doesn't have a dedicated level 7 in lore, the Advanced Deck isn't particularly likely to give her a game-changing replacement for Ruin Mode, which means demand will likely be high.
Chaosmon Valdur Arm is pretty cheap right now, but I can't guarantee it'll stay that way. Its "intended" deck is already rogue-playable, and while it isn't an obvious candidate for new support in the near future based on announced set themes, it can't be ruled out entirely It's also proven itself to be viable in other off-archetype decks that happen to be in the right colors and either already stack level 6s (Vortex Warriors and Xros Heart), easily play out level 6s (Xros Heart again and Three Great Angels), or just happen to be in Yellow and have room for it and the splashable MedievalGallantmon (which is even more of a bank-breaker than Ruin Mode). Combined with the Special Boosters' bigger card count meaning a more dilute SR pool, I could definitely see this going up.
Sakuyamon X seems like an unlikely candidate for a reprint in the main part of the Advanced Deck, and she's already the most expensive archetypal Sakuyamon card. Taomon Ace also seems relatively unlikely, and shares the Special Booster issue with Valdur Arm. But they could be in the bonus cards so who knows.

>>96155678The new Yao herself is fine but Ariemon and GigaSeadramon are in some ways too similar to work well together, I think. They both want to be loaded up with Digimon sources when you evolve into them to play out with their effects, so anything you play out with Giga is one less thing to play out with Arie. And without Arie, since GigaSeadramon itself isn't a Liberator, that makes the Unique Emblem worse. I think the Sangomon/Shellmon/MarineBullmon cards in general are more or less fine to use as a base for Giga, aside from the fact that they don't give you any particular ways to look for X-Anti Options aside from just a few draw 1s. The inherit on the MarineBullmons is a kind-of okay backup to finding an X-Antibody or MetalSeadramon for GigaSeadramon, aside from being on End of Attack instead of GigaSeadramon's When Attacking. If you do find X-Antibody or Metal though, it becomes redundant. And of course, there's the recurring problem of the only viable MetalSeadramon being an Ace.
There's some potential, but it's not yet realized. I do really like the fact that the X-Antibody options trigger both BT22 and promo Yao, at least.
